MSc Programme Administrator

Posted by Prospect Us.

Our client, a leading London University, is currently looking to recruit an enthusiastic and dedicated MSc Course Administrator. The post is to start as soon as possible and is a full-time (35 hours per week), ongoing role. The post will be 5-days on site Monday-Friday, based in Chelsea & Farringdon.

Key responsibilities for this post will include:

  • Assisting the MSc Course Team in the preparation, organisation and running of student registration and induction events
  • Assisting with maintaining a complete teaching timetable for the year
  • Providing administrative support to lecturers and students
  • Liaising with venue staff for the preparation of the teaching and office spaces
  • Creating, maintaining, and handling student records and data
  • Assisting with uploading content into the virtual learning environment
  • Assisting the Postgraduate Teaching Coordinator with Assessment administration

To be considered for this role you will have:

  • Worked in a similar post previously, ideally from a higher education setting or a similar organisation in the wider not for profit sector.
  • Experience within a fast-paced, customer facing environment.
  • Excellent organisational and time management skills
  • Excellent IT skills, including MS Office suite of products and the ability to use bespoke systems.
  • Knowledge of GDPR standards and respect for confidentiality of personal information.
